  2. This was an interesting time for my son because he was struggling with dropping down to 1 nap. In hindsight a lot of our sleep issues & issues with early morning waking were a result of needing to drop down to 1 nap.1-What was your child's optimal waketime length for 12-15 months old?I thought it was 3hrs but it was really closer to 4.5!2-What time was your child's morning waketime (what time did he/she get up) at 12-15 months?7am has always been our home's waketime but DS was up at 5:30 or 6am talking in his crib most days during this time.3-What time was your child's bedtime at 12-15 months?7pm. No change here.4-How many hours did your child usually sleep at night at 12-15 months?10-11 when he was taking 2 naps, and then back to 12 once we dropped down to 1 nap. 5-How many naps did your child take a day at 12-15 months?2 for the beginning of this period and 1 by the end.6-How long was each nap usually at 12-15 months?With 2 naps he was doing one 1.5-2hrs nap then usually a 45 minute nap. Once we dropped down to 1 nap he would sleep 3hrs.7-Looking at all of the sleep as a whole, do you think your child was getting the sleep that was ideal for your child at that age range?Yes. Once we got over the awkward transition to 1 nap things were perfect!

  6. 1. Optimal Waketime 12-15months:2 Hours from morning wake time to first nap and then 3 hours from wake from nap to 2nd nap and 3 hours from 2nd nap wake to bedtime. (Dropped to one afternoon nap around 13.5 months)Wake times afterwards roughly 4 hours. 2. Child's morning wake time:Between 8am and 8:30am3. Child's bedtime:Between 8pm and 8:30pm4. How many hours of night sleep:12 hrs5. How many naps a day:Started with still 2 at 12 months dropped to 1 at 13.5 months and did great6. How long did naps last?With two naps each nap was 2 hours. When dropping to one afternoon nap it last 3 hours.7. Do you think your child was getting enough sleep for this age range?Yes. He did great with two naps but then was ready to drop to one as he stopped napping well for the second nap after sleeping for 2 hours during his first nap. I gradually increased his wake time laying him down a little later each day and he adjusted perfectly.
